1. Product Overview
The T'nB AIR Light Bluetooth LED Headphones (Model CBLEDBK) offer a versatile audio experience with 3-in-1 connectivity: Bluetooth wireless, wired via 3.5mm jack, and Micro-SD card playback. Featuring Bluetooth 5.0, an integrated microphone, and LED lighting, these headphones are designed for daily use and music listening.
Image 1.1: Front view of the T'nB AIR Light Bluetooth LED Headphones, showcasing the earcups and headband.
Key Features:
- 3-in-1 Connectivity: Bluetooth 5.0, 3.5mm audio jack, and Micro-SD card reader.
- Integrated Microphone: For hands-free calls.
- LED Lighting: Stylish illumination on earcups.
- Long Battery Life: Up to 8 hours of playback.
- Comfortable Design: Supra-aural (over-ear) fit and foldable for portability.
- Active Noise Suppression: For an immersive listening experience.

3. Setup
3.1. Charging the Headphones
- Connect the supplied Micro USB charging cable to the charging port on the headphones.
- Connect the other end of the cable to a USB power source (e.g., computer USB port, USB wall adapter).
- The LED indicator on the headphones will illuminate during charging and turn off or change color once fully charged.
- A full charge typically takes approximately 2-3 hours.
3.2. Powering On/Off
- To Power On: Press and hold the Power button (often combined with Play/Pause) for approximately 3-5 seconds until the LED indicator lights up and an audible prompt is heard.
- To Power Off: Press and hold the Power button for approximately 3-5 seconds until the LED indicator turns off and an audible prompt is heard.
3.3. Bluetooth Pairing
- Ensure the headphones are fully charged and powered off.
- Press and hold the Power button for approximately 5-7 seconds until the LED indicator flashes rapidly (usually blue and red), indicating pairing mode.
- On your Bluetooth-enabled device (smartphone, tablet, computer), go to the Bluetooth settings and enable Bluetooth.
- Search for available devices. Select "T'nB AIR Light" from the list.
- Once paired, the LED indicator will typically flash slowly or turn solid blue, and an audible confirmation will be heard.
3.4. Wired Connection (3.5mm Audio Cable)
- Insert one end of the 3.5mm audio cable into the audio input jack on the headphones.
- Insert the other end into the 3.5mm audio output jack of your audio device.
- In wired mode, the headphones do not require power, and Bluetooth functionality is disabled.
3.5. Micro-SD Card Playback
- With the headphones powered on, gently insert a Micro-SD card (with audio files) into the designated slot until it clicks into place.
- The headphones should automatically switch to Micro-SD card playback mode.
- Use the control buttons (Play/Pause, Next/Previous) to manage playback.

4.2. Call Management
- Answer/End Call: Short press the Power/Play/Pause button.
- Reject Call: Long press the Power/Play/Pause button during an incoming call.
- Redial Last Number: Double-press the Power/Play/Pause button.

5. Maintenance
5.1. Cleaning
- Use a soft, dry, lint-free cloth to clean the surfaces of the headphones.
- Do not use abrasive cleaners, solvents, or strong chemicals, as these may damage the finish or internal components.
- Avoid getting moisture into any openings.
5.2. Storage
- Store the headphones in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
- When not in use for extended periods, store them in their original packaging or a protective case.
- The foldable design allows for compact storage.
5.3. Battery Care
- To prolong battery life, avoid fully discharging the headphones frequently.
- Charge the headphones regularly, even if not used often.
- Avoid exposing the battery to extreme heat or cold.
6.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your headphones, refer to the following common problems and solutions:
6.1. No Power
- Solution: Ensure the headphones are fully charged. Connect them to a power source using the Micro USB cable and allow sufficient time for charging.
6.2. Cannot Pair via Bluetooth
- Solution 1: Ensure the headphones are in pairing mode (LED flashing rapidly).
- Solution 2: Make sure Bluetooth is enabled on your device and it is within range (typically 10 meters).
- Solution 3: Turn off and on Bluetooth on your device, then try searching again.
- Solution 4: If previously paired, try forgetting the device from your Bluetooth list and re-pairing.
6.3. No Sound or Low Volume
- Solution 1: Check the volume level on both the headphones and your connected device.
- Solution 2: Ensure the headphones are properly connected (Bluetooth paired or 3.5mm cable fully inserted).
- Solution 3: If using Micro-SD card, ensure the audio files are in a compatible format and the card is inserted correctly.
6.4. Poor Sound Quality
- Solution 1: Move closer to your Bluetooth device to reduce interference.
- Solution 2: Avoid obstacles between the headphones and your device.
- Solution 3: Try playing audio from a different source or file to rule out source issues.
7. Specifications
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model Number | CBLEDBK |
| Bluetooth Version | 5.0 |
| Connectivity | Bluetooth, 3.5mm Jack, Micro-SD Card |
| Battery Life (Playback) | Up to 8 hours |
| Sensitivity | 82 dB |
| Impedance | 32 Ohms |
| Noise Control | Active Noise Suppression |
| Microphone | Integrated |
| Form Factor | Supra-aural (Over-ear) |
| Material | Plastic |
| Color | Black |
| Features | Volume Control, Foldable, Universal Compatibility |
8. Safety Information
- Hearing Protection: Avoid using headphones at high volume levels for extended periods to prevent hearing damage.
- Environmental Awareness: Do not use headphones in situations where you need to hear your surroundings (e.g., driving, cycling, walking in traffic).
- Water and Moisture: These headphones are not waterproof. Avoid exposure to water, rain, or excessive moisture.
- Disposal: Dispose of the product and its battery responsibly according to local regulations. Do not dispose of with household waste.
- Children: Keep out of reach of small children due to small parts that could pose a choking hazard.
